The Son

195226 min 40 secFilm: Fiction

Direction: Julian Biggs

Production: Michael Spencer

Script: Julian Biggs

A dramatic portrayal of a not infrequent rural problem: the tendency of farmers' sons to leave the land in favour of other employment. The serene pastoral countryside of southern Ontario provides the story background. Howard, an only son, has grown to manhood under his father's domination, working for a weekly pittance that offers no independence. His resentment finally threatens a complete break from the farm. A legal partnership agreement between father and son provides an amicable solution.
